Select a bracketing increment.
Pressing the D button and rotate the sub-command dial to choose a 
bracketing increment.
4
Frame a photograph, focus, and shoot.
The camera will vary exposure and/or flash level shot-by-
shot according to the bracketing program selected. 
Modifications to exposure are added to those made with 
exposure compensation (0 112), making it possible to achieve exposure 
compensation values of more than 5 EV.
While bracketing is in effect, a bracketing progress indicator will be displayed in 
the control panel. A segment will disappear from the indicator after each shot: 
the y segment when the unmodified shot is taken, the z segment when the 
shot with the negative increment is taken, and the x segment when the shot 
with the positive increment is taken.
To cancel bracketing, press the D button and rotate the main command dial until 
the bracketing progress indicator and M icon are no longer displayed.
